近年来,随着移动设备硬件性能的持续提升以及用户对沉浸式数字体验需求的不断增长,AR动画开发正逐步从概念走向成熟应用。无论是品牌营销、教育互动,还是游戏娱乐与工业可视化,高质量的AR动画已成为连接虚拟与现实的重要桥梁。在这一过程中,架构设计作为技术实现的核心环节,直接决定了动画的流畅度、响应速度和整体用户体验。一个科学合理的架构不仅能够有效降低开发复杂度,还能显著提升系统的可维护性与扩展性,为后续功能迭代打下坚实基础。
在进行AR动画开发时,开发者面临的首要挑战并非创意本身,而是如何将复杂的视觉效果与实时交互逻辑高效整合。此时,架构设计的作用便凸显出来——它不仅是代码组织的方式,更是系统稳定运行的保障。模块化设计是当前主流的架构策略之一,通过将动画资源管理、场景渲染、用户输入处理等功能拆分为独立模块,可以实现各组件间的松耦合,从而提升开发效率并降低出错概率。例如,在一个AR导览应用中,将地图数据加载、3D模型展示与手势识别分别封装为独立服务,不仅便于团队协作,也使得后期优化更具针对性。
此外,实时渲染优化同样是架构设计中不可忽视的一环。由于AR动画需要在真实环境中叠加虚拟内容,对帧率和延迟的要求极为严苛。因此,采用基于GPU加速的渲染管线,并结合动态资源加载与异步预处理机制,能有效缓解设备负载压力。特别是在低配机型上,合理的内存管理与纹理压缩策略,能大幅减少卡顿现象,确保动画始终流畅呈现。

随着多终端应用场景的普及,跨平台兼容性成为衡量一套架构是否成熟的标尺。在实际开发中,同一套AR动画需适配iOS、Android甚至Web端,这对架构的通用性提出了更高要求。采用统一的中间层抽象(如基于Unity或Cocos Creator的跨平台引擎),配合针对不同平台的差异化配置策略,可以在保证核心逻辑一致的前提下,灵活应对各设备的特性差异。同时,通过引入自动化测试框架,可在早期发现因平台差异引发的渲染异常或交互失效问题,从而提前规避风险。
在性能方面,资源占用过高的问题常出现在大型场景或高精度模型导入时。对此,建议采取“按需加载”与“资源池复用”的策略:仅在用户视线范围内加载必要的动画资源,并在后台预缓存可能用到的内容;对于重复出现的元素(如按钮图标、粒子特效),建立共享资源池以减少重复创建带来的内存开销。这些细节虽小,却能在长期使用中显著改善系统稳定性与用户满意度。
科学的架构设计不仅能解决技术难题,更能为企业创造可观的商业价值。据实际项目反馈,经过优化后的AR动画开发流程,平均可提升开发效率约30%,而用户留存率也因体验流畅度的提高而明显上升。例如,在某零售品牌的AR试妆应用中,通过重构底层架构,实现了毫秒级的镜像同步与表情捕捉,用户停留时长较原版本增长了近50%。这充分说明,良好的架构不是“锦上添花”,而是决定产品成败的关键因素。
更重要的是,当架构具备足够的灵活性与可扩展性时,企业便能快速响应市场变化,推出新功能或拓展新场景。无论是从静态展示转向动态交互,还是从单一设备接入发展为多设备联动,稳定的架构都为创新提供了可靠支撑。这也意味着,企业在投入初期进行扎实的架构规划,实际上是在为未来的可持续发展“铺路”。
在这一背景下,我们专注于为客户提供专业的AR动画开发服务,涵盖从前期需求分析、架构设计到最终交付的全流程支持。我们的团队拥有丰富的实战经验,擅长结合业务场景定制高效、稳定的技术方案,尤其在模块化架构搭建、实时渲染优化及跨平台适配方面表现突出。无论是品牌宣传、教育培训,还是智能展厅与工业仿真,我们都能提供贴合实际需求的解决方案。18140119082


